How To Choose The Best Men’s Water Bottle

Every guy needs a water bottle that matches his life, not a marketing claim. Here’s what separates a solid daily driver from a bottle that ends up in the back of a closet.

Insulation That Actually Works

Double-wall vacuum insulation is the gold standard. Look for claims of 12–24 hours of cold retention — that means ice still clinking at the end of the day. Single-wall or thin stainless steel bottles will sweat and warm up fast. A bottle that keeps your water cold is a bottle you’ll actually drink from.

Lid Type and How You Drink

Straw lids are perfect for driving or sipping at a desk, but add complexity to cleaning. Chug caps are ideal for fast gulps after a workout — fewer parts, easier to clean. Twist caps are the most leak-proof design but require two hands. Pick the lid that fits how you actually drink water throughout the day.

Capacity and Carry

A 24 oz bottle disappears into a backpack and fits most car cup holders. A 32 oz or 40 oz bottle cuts refills but feels heavier and may stick out of a standard cup holder. Consider your typical day: desk job vs field work vs gym session dictates the right size. The handle or carry loop design also matters for easy grabbing on the go.

How do I know if a bottle will fit my car cup holder?
Check the base diameter spec. Standard car cup holders range from 2.8 to 3.5 inches wide. The Owala FreeSip (3.24 inches) and CamelBak Thrive (3.27 inches) fit most. The Klean Kanteen TKWide (3.65 inches) and larger 40 oz tumblers may not fit deeper cup holders. If cup holder fit is non-negotiable, measure your car’s cup holder diameter before buying.
Why does my stainless steel water bottle taste metallic?
A metallic taste usually comes from low-grade stainless steel or insufficient finishing. Premium bottles like the Klean Kanteen TKWide use high-grade 18/8 stainless steel and often include an all-stainless steel straw, eliminating any plastic contact. Budget bottles may use lower-grade steel or plastic components that cause off-tastes. Washing the bottle with baking soda and warm water can help remove manufacturing residues if the taste appears initially.
